"Ap Phuntsho won't be able to make it this time" I heard my neighbors
chattering around. I felt misearable and it was unbearable for me to hear those detrimental words. It was already difficult for me and my sister to deal with the  situation where mother had to take care of my father and she rarely  get to spend time with us as she need to take father for checkup and to get blessing from great lamas to gain merits. So, it was me and my sister taking every responsibilities at home. We have to wake up early in the morning, feed cattle, clean house and prepare food to ourselves. Exactly around 7'o clock we would with done with the work and ready for school. After school periods end we would rush back to home as we have many things scheduled. We have to collect folders,  feed cattle and do household chores. Sometimes we even have to roam in the forest in search of fire wood. I was only in class five and my sister was one step ahead of me. It was very difficult for us to take multiple roles at very young age. We had a hard times at school. Homework's are left incomplete, could not perform well in the class and moreover one of the backbreaking thing is we are not able to concentrate to the lesson being taught in the class. At times we thought world is so cruel and treating us badly. On the contrary, those bad days were blessing to us. It was during that time that made me realize how difficult it was for our parents and how much sacrifices that had to made for their child. If not for that incidence i would not have been able to  grow up to this. Now I can understanding the understand the harsh realities of life. My father is able to make it to normal and I am more than happy for what I had experienced. We are leading a happy and peaceful life. I want all of you to stay strong and always be positive to things around us. Don't ever let yourself down. After all life is not a problem to solved, it is a reality to be experienced.
